This work is a tribute to the poet Minou Drouet, who in September 1955, when she was only eight years old, amazed French critics and readers with the publication of a volume of beautiful poems. The image, in the original version, is on the first page of the "Domenica del Corriere" of January 20, 1957. Minou, a child prodigy, was received by Pope Pius XII in the Vatican, in the Sala del Tronetto.

With acquasumARTE Visual & Performing Art I create and implement multidisciplinary projects that hybridize performance, urban art and multimedia. I alternate the activity of video-creator and performer dedicating myself to the processing of recycled materials, mainly wood. I'm here as a guest of Saatchi Art to show you my works, created completely using recycled materials: from the type of support used, mainly wood, to the way in which I carry out the coloring. For collages I use images from old magazines and newspapers. The technique I use to paint I have been experimenting and developing for several years. I don't use traditional colors (acrylic or oil), but I get it through the transfer of colors and images. I "extract" the color from the pages of Ikea catalogs and supermarket advertising flyers by means of water-based solvents and then apply it to the wood, creating paintings, small sculptures, or transforming the base of used Lack Ikea tables, from low-cost serial objects to unique pieces. From this application technique, that recalls the tattoo and the use of Ikea catalogs, my brand originated: like a tattoo. "L Ikea Tattoo" Mine is an aesthetic reflection on the world of image and communication, on the globalized and consumerist society, which translates into an artistic action of reuse, recovery, transformation of the materials that companies consume quickly and throw away, such as waste and wood scraps from a carpentry shop located right in front of my workshop / studio, like the enormous quantity of printed paper in catalogs and advertising flyers that pushes us to be more and more consumers of the superfluous.
